Output d11409fba2f8f34c63407e53c6c3dbce0882f76487b90956065fda94b0e8102f:1

value
76151
script pubkey
OP_HASH160 OP_PUSHBYTES_20 870135bf84dfe0d4e312ace1a97cfa8499d0149f OP_EQUAL
address
3DzrbWXbHEXYTb7Db1YnYEY5tmpH2Wq1Yv
transaction
d11409fba2f8f34c63407e53c6c3dbce0882f76487b90956065fda94b0e8102f
spent
true